Niobium
Niobium- It is the chemical element with the symbol Nb and the atomic number 41. A rare, grey, soft, ductile transition metal, niobium is found in the minerals pyrochlore, the key commercial source for niobium, and columbite. Niobium has physical and chemical properties similar to those of the element tantalum, and the two are thus difficult to distinguish
